Course Overview

Course Overview The Master of Film and Television is an integrated coursework Masters with two specialisations - Filmmaking and Screen Producing. The program is for creatives interested in extending their skills in different types of cinematic storytelling and encourages applications from both fiction and documentary filmmakers and screen producers working across genres. The Master of Film and Television offers you intensive, studio-based training in film and TV across producing, writing, directing, and editing for the screen, preparing you for professional work in the industry. Key Program Highlights Students will be supported to develop their own individual screen voices and gain an understanding of both established and emerging screen cultures and storytelling cultures. Across two years you will write, direct and edit two films and develop a third project ready to pitch to the marketplace. The course features studio-based intensive classes with a range of industry guest lecturers, as well as β€˜insider’ Q&A sessions with visiting filmmakers. You will develop enduring peer networks throughout the program, which are instrumental to the realisation of your professional projects out in the industry. In addition to directing your own projects, you will collaborate with your peers in Screen Producing to bring your films to life.
